Grammy Award-winning artist Charles Yang brings you a dazzling night of classical virtuosity, jazzy rhythms and soulful grooves!

Recipient of the Leonard Bernstein Award, violinist and vocalist Charles Yang is renowned for his excellence across genres. A Juilliard graduate with classical roots, Charles transcends classical boundaries. He seamlessly blends classical and contemporary elements, bringing genre-defying creativity and electrifying energy to the stage.

Charles’ remarkable multiple talents have made him a sought-after performer at prestigious venues and festivals worldwide, including Carnegie Hall, the Musikverein, the Aspen Music Festival, the Schleswig-Holstein Music Festival, among many others. Charles is also the violinist and lead singer of the Grammy Award-winning string band Time For Three.

In this Hong Kong recital debut, Charles, together with his frequent collaborator, pianist Peter Dugan, will bring a genre-blending programme spanning from Monti and Ravel to The Beatles and jazz sets, in Charles and Peter’s own arrangements. This concert promises a fresh and exhilarating musical experience.
